  • Hospital Emergency Codes — Colour Studies
    Not all hospitals follow the same colour coding system; variations do exist However, some classic colour associations are common to most codes – like red for fire, yellow for missing patient and white for a violent situation Each hospital posts emergency colour code signs throughout the facility

  • Hospital emergency codes - Wikipedia
    Consistent across the thirteen states with uniform codes as of 2020 were code red (fire), code blue (cardiac arrest and or medical emergency), and code orange (hazardous material spill release)

  • What are the standard hospital emergency codes and the required . . .
    Hospital Emergency Codes and Response Actions While there is no universally mandated standard for hospital emergency codes in the United States, the most widely adopted system uses color-based codes, with "Code Red" for fire, "Code Blue" for cardiac arrest, "Code Pink" for infant child abduction, and "Code White" for emergency deactivation
